.download {
	float:left;
	width:100%;
	}
.download .download-top {
	float:left;
	width:100%;
	height:35px;
	line-height:35px;
	text-align:center;
	font-size:14px;
	font-weight:bold;
	background: linear-gradient(to bottom,#f6de90 0%,#c49c1d 67%,#a36f12 100%);
	color: #fff;
	}	
.download .download-mid {
	float:left;
	width:100%;
	margin-top: 15px;
	}
.download .download-mid ul{
	margin:0 0;
	padding:0 0;
	}	
.download .download-mid ul li{
	margin: 0 0 2px 0;
	padding: 10px 0 0 0;
	background-color: #fff;
	text-indent: 20px;
	-webkit-border-radius: 3px;
	-moz-border-radius: 3px;
	border-radius: 3px;
	}	
.download .download-mid ul li .download-title{
	margin: 0 0;
	padding: 0 0 5px 0;
	/* font-weight:bold; */
	}	
.download .download-mid ul li .download-title a{
	color: #000;
	/* margin: 9px 0; */
	}	
.download .download-mid ul li .download-title a:hover{
	color: #FF711F;
	}
.download .download-mid ul li span.download-file1{
	margin: 0 0;
	padding: 0 0;
	font-weight:normal;
	text-decoration:underline;
	}	
.download .download-mid ul li span.download-file1 a{
	color:#06F;
	}	
.download .download-mid ul li span.download-file1 a:hover{
	color:#06F;
	}	
.download .download-mid ul li .download-active{
	margin: 0 0;
	padding: 3px 11px;
	background:url(../images/download/icon_down_active.png);
	}	
.download .download-mid ul li .download-normal{
	margin: 0 0;
	padding: 3px 11px;
	background:url(../images/download/icon_down.png);
	}		
.download .download-mid ul li .download-sub{
	margin:0 0;
	padding:0 0;
	}
.download .download-mid ul li .download-sub ul{
	margin:0 0;
	padding: 5px 0;
	background-color: #fff;
	}	
.download .download-mid ul li .download-sub ul li{
	margin: 0 0 5px 35px;
	padding: 0px 0 5px 5px;
	background:none;
	}
.download .download-mid ul li .download-sub ul li a{
	color:#000;
	}
.download .download-mid ul li .download-sub ul li a:hover{
	color: #FF711F;
	}	

/* set background color */
.download .download-mid ul li, .download .download-mid ul li .download-sub ul {
	background-color: #f0f0f0;
}	